Celluloid Verdict

A gleefully pulpy revenge fantasy with a real wound underneath — its bureau-of-vigilante-teachers premise shouldn't work, but committed turns from Kim Moo-yul and Lee Sung-min make the catharsis land.

What is Teach You a Lesson about?

When school bullying spirals beyond anything teachers or courts can touch, South Korea's Ministry of Education quietly stands up a covert Teachers' Rights Protection Bureau — and dispatches its most dangerous agent, ex-Special Forces captain Na Hwa-jin, to campuses where students and parents alike have stopped fearing consequences. Adapted from a hit webtoon, the series stages discipline as full-contact spectacle while asking who failed these classrooms first.
